字符编码python解释器在加载.py文件中的代码时,会对内容进行编码(默认ASCII)二进制举例:古时候烽火台,点火和不点火只有两种状态,传递信息太少。约定点火数1,代表1-100点火数2,代表101-1000点火数3,代表1001-5000点火数4,代表5001-1000虽然有进步,但还不够精确如果引..
分类:
编程语言 时间:
2016-12-23 02:15:11
阅读次数:
156
字符编码python解释器在加载.py文件中的代码时,会对内容进行编码(默认ASCII)二进制举例:古时候烽火台,点火和不点火只有两种状态,传递信息太少。约定点火数1,代表1-100点火数2,代表101-1000点火数3,代表1001-5000点火数4,代表5001-1000虽然有进步,但还不够精确如果引..
分类:
编程语言 时间:
2016-12-23 02:13:24
阅读次数:
122
1、编译python:下载.tgz文件,解压缩文件,执行以下操作进行python的编译:./configure; make; make install; 2、python脚本的扩展名是.py;在脚本的第一行写上python解释器的完整路径;#!/usr/local/bin/python;#!/usr ...
分类:
编程语言 时间:
2016-12-22 20:21:12
阅读次数:
149
一.关于Python多线程 Python解释器中可以同时运行多个线程,但是再任意时刻只能有一个线程在解释器运行。 Python虚拟机的访问是由全局解锁器(GIL)控制的,由GIL保证同时只有一个线程的运行。 执行方式如下: 1.设置GIL 2.切换进一个进程执行 3.执行下面操作中的一个 a.运行指 ...
分类:
编程语言 时间:
2016-12-20 00:37:34
阅读次数:
319
CentOS6.7安装Python3.51、安装开发包和依赖包yumgroupinstall‘DevelopmentTools‘ #安装开发包yuminstallzlib-develbzip2-developenssl-develncurses-devel##安装可能依赖的包yuminstallreadline-devel-y ##不安装进入python解释器的时候可能输入字符会乱码2、下载Python3.5代..
分类:
编程语言 时间:
2016-12-15 18:33:56
阅读次数:
208
运算符是一些符号,它告诉Python解释器去做一些数学或逻辑操作。一些基本的数学操作符如下所示:>>>a=8+9
>>>a
17
>>>b=1/3
>>>b
0.3333333333333333
>>>c=3*5
>>>c
15
>>>4%3
1下面是一个计算天数的脚本#/usr..
分类:
编程语言 时间:
2016-12-13 00:18:26
阅读次数:
261
运算符是一些符号,它告诉Python解释器去做一些数学或逻辑操作。一些基本的数学操作符如下所示:>>>a=8+9
>>>a
17
>>>b=1/3
>>>b
0.3333333333333333
>>>c=3*5
>>>c
15
>>>4%3
1下面是一个计算天数的脚本#/usr..
分类:
编程语言 时间:
2016-12-13 00:18:08
阅读次数:
287
python程序的运行方式大致可以分为两种,一种是直接通过python解释器直接解释型运行,另外一种是先把python程序编译为二进制文件再运行。 ...
分类:
编程语言 时间:
2016-12-05 02:19:29
阅读次数:
289
如果导入的模块不存在,Python解释器会报 ImportError 错误: 有的时候,两个不同的模块提供了相同的功能,比如 StringIO 和 cStringIO 都提供了StringIO这个功能。 这是因为Python是动态语言,解释执行,因此Python代码运行速度慢。 如果要提高Pytho ...
分类:
编程语言 时间:
2016-12-03 21:00:35
阅读次数:
298
安装PythonPythonx官网:https://www.python.org/Download:https://www.python.org/downloads/Python官方提供了WindowsLinuxMac安装包:(我将给同学们重要说明一下Windows环境的设置)Windows安装方式:(python2.7.x)1、https://www.python.org/ftp/python/2.7.12/python-2..
分类:
编程语言 时间:
2016-12-02 16:45:14
阅读次数:
334